Summary
If you make 474,266 kr a year living in the region of Fredensborg, Denmark, you will be taxed 155,069 kr. That means that your net pay will be 319,197 kr per year, or 26,600 kr per month. Your average tax rate is 32.7% and your marginal tax rate is 35.0%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 kr in your salary will be taxed 34.95 kr, hence, your net pay will only increase by 65.05 kr.
Bonus Example
A 1,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 651 kr of net incomes. A 5,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 3,253 kr of net incomes.
